The size of Brighton East is approximately 5.7 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 13.9% of the total area. The population of Brighton East in 2016 was 15998 people. By 2021 the population was 16757 showing a population growth of 4.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brighton East is 10-19 years. Households in Brighton East are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brighton East work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.80% of the homes in Brighton East were owner-occupied compared with 74.50% in 2016.
